Breeder and sportsman . U2» dams of San Francisco 2:07%. Mona Wilkes 2:03M. etc. Ham Dalita fl\ ?«ln dam of 3 in list; second dam Elsie, dam of 5; third dam Elaine 2:20,ISdlll, rdllld yi, j , dam of 4, fourth dam Green Mountain Maid, dam of 9. PALITE is the sire of the 2-year-old stake-winner Pal 2:171/i and the 3-year-old filly Complete second to the Occident Stake winner El Volante in 2:13%, andtimed separately in 2:14%, and sire of Nat Higgins (3) 2:20 trotting, CorneliaScott (3) 2:24*4 pacing. Palite is one of the best-bred stallions of the Wilkes-Klectioneer cross living. His colts are all trotters, good-gaited and determined. He will make the season of 1912 at the ranch of the undersigned at DIXON, CAL.
